The cheapest way to get from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port is to drive which costs £8 - £12 and takes 1h 6m.
The fastest way to get from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port is to train which takes 52 min and costs £22 - £27.
No, there is no direct bus from Isle of Dogs station to Gatwick Airport station. However, there are services departing from South Quay Station DLR and arriving at South Terminal Coach Station via Stratford City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 38m.
No, there is no direct train from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port. However, there are services departing from Canary Wharf and arriving at Gatwick Airport via Farringdon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 52 min.
The distance between Isle of Dogs and Gatwick Airport is 32 miles. The road distance is 33.2 miles.
The best way to get from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port without a car is to train which takes 52 min and costs £22 - £27.
It takes approximately 52 min to get from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port, including transfers.
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port bus services, operated by Stagecoach London, depart from South Quay Station DLR.
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port train services, operated by Thameslink, depart from Farringdon station.
The best way to get from Isle of Dogs to Gatwick Airport is to train which takes 52 min and costs £22 - £27.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£9 - £12 and takes 2h 38m.

Thameslink operates a train from Farringdon to Gatwick Airport every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£15–19 and the journey takes 39 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from South Quay Station DLR to South Terminal Coach Station via Stratford Bus Station and Stratford City Bus Station in around 2h 38m.
